PrestoLinkedService interface

Kiszolgálóhoz társított presto szolgáltatás. Ez a társított szolgáltatás támogatott verziótulajdonságú. Az 1.0-s verzió elavulásra van ütemezve, míg a folyamat az EOL után is fut, hibajavítás vagy új funkciók nélkül.

Extends

Tulajdonságok

allowHostNameCNMismatch

Megadja, hogy a hitelesítésszolgáltató által kibocsátott SSL-tanúsítványnévnek meg kell-e felelnie a kiszolgáló állomásnevének, amikor SSL-kapcsolaton keresztül csatlakozik. Az alapértelmezett érték hamis. Csak az 1.0-s verzióhoz használható.

allowSelfSignedServerCert

Megadja, hogy engedélyezi-e az önaláírt tanúsítványokat a kiszolgálóról. Az alapértelmezett érték hamis. Csak az 1.0-s verzióhoz használható.

authenticationType

A Presto-kiszolgálóhoz való csatlakozáshoz használt hitelesítési mechanizmus.

catalog

A kiszolgálóra irányuló összes kérés katalóguskörnyezete.

enableServerCertificateValidation

Megadja, hogy a kiszolgálóhoz való kapcsolatok érvényesítik-e a kiszolgálótanúsítványt, az alapértelmezett érték Igaz. Csak a 2.0-s verzióhoz használható

enableSsl

Megadja, hogy a kiszolgálóhoz való kapcsolatok SSL-sel vannak-e titkosítva. Az örökölt verzió alapértelmezett értéke Hamis. A 2.0-s verzió alapértelmezett értéke Igaz.

encryptedCredential

A hitelesítéshez használt titkosított hitelesítő adatok. A hitelesítő adatok titkosítása az integrációs futtatókörnyezet hitelesítő adatainak kezelőjével történik. Típus: sztring.

host

A Presto-kiszolgáló IP-címe vagy állomásneve. (azaz 192.168.222.160)

password

A felhasználónévnek megfelelő jelszó.

port

A Presto-kiszolgáló által az ügyfélkapcsolatok figyelésére használt TCP-port. Az SSL letiltásakor az alapértelmezett érték 8080, az SSL engedélyezése esetén az alapértelmezett érték 443.

serverVersion

A Presto-kiszolgáló verziója. (azaz 0,148-t) Csak az 1.0-s verzióhoz használható.

timeZoneID

A kapcsolat által használt helyi időzóna. A beállítás érvényes értékei az IANA időzóna-adatbázisában vannak megadva. Az 1.0-s verzió alapértelmezett értéke az ügyfélrendszer időzónája. A 2.0-s verzió alapértelmezett értéke a kiszolgálórendszer időzónája

trustedCertPath

A .pem fájl teljes elérési útja, amely megbízható hitelesítésszolgáltatói tanúsítványokat tartalmaz a kiszolgáló SSL-kapcsolaton keresztüli csatlakozáskor történő ellenőrzéséhez. Ez a tulajdonság csak akkor állítható be, ha SSL-t használ a saját üzemeltetésű integrációs modulon. Az alapértelmezett érték az integrációs modullal telepített cacerts.pem fájl. Csak az 1.0-s verzióhoz használható.

type

Polimorfikus diszkriminatív, amely meghatározza az objektum különböző típusait

username

A Presto-kiszolgálóhoz való csatlakozáshoz használt felhasználónév.

useSystemTrustStore

Megadja, hogy a rendszer megbízhatósági tárolójából vagy egy megadott PEM-fájlból használjon-e ca-tanúsítványt. Az alapértelmezett érték hamis. Csak az 1.0-s verzióhoz használható.

Örökölt tulajdonságok

annotations

A társított szolgáltatás leírásához használható címkék listája.

connectVia

Az integrációs modul referenciája.

description

Társított szolgáltatás leírása.

parameters

A társított szolgáltatás paraméterei.

version

A társított szolgáltatás verziója.

Tulajdonság adatai

allowHostNameCNMismatch

Megadja, hogy a hitelesítésszolgáltató által kibocsátott SSL-tanúsítványnévnek meg kell-e felelnie a kiszolgáló állomásnevének, amikor SSL-kapcsolaton keresztül csatlakozik. Az alapértelmezett érték hamis. Csak az 1.0-s verzióhoz használható.

allowHostNameCNMismatch?: any

Tulajdonság értéke

any

allowSelfSignedServerCert

Megadja, hogy engedélyezi-e az önaláírt tanúsítványokat a kiszolgálóról. Az alapértelmezett érték hamis. Csak az 1.0-s verzióhoz használható.

allowSelfSignedServerCert?: any

Tulajdonság értéke

any

authenticationType

A Presto-kiszolgálóhoz való csatlakozáshoz használt hitelesítési mechanizmus.

authenticationType: string

Tulajdonság értéke

string

catalog

A kiszolgálóra irányuló összes kérés katalóguskörnyezete.

catalog: any

Tulajdonság értéke

any

enableServerCertificateValidation

Megadja, hogy a kiszolgálóhoz való kapcsolatok érvényesítik-e a kiszolgálótanúsítványt, az alapértelmezett érték Igaz. Csak a 2.0-s verzióhoz használható

enableServerCertificateValidation?: any

Tulajdonság értéke

any

enableSsl

Megadja, hogy a kiszolgálóhoz való kapcsolatok SSL-sel vannak-e titkosítva. Az örökölt verzió alapértelmezett értéke Hamis. A 2.0-s verzió alapértelmezett értéke Igaz.

enableSsl?: any

Tulajdonság értéke

any

encryptedCredential

A hitelesítéshez használt titkosított hitelesítő adatok. A hitelesítő adatok titkosítása az integrációs futtatókörnyezet hitelesítő adatainak kezelőjével történik. Típus: sztring.

encryptedCredential?: string

Tulajdonság értéke

string

host

A Presto-kiszolgáló IP-címe vagy állomásneve. (azaz 192.168.222.160)

host: any

Tulajdonság értéke

any

password

A felhasználónévnek megfelelő jelszó.

password?: SecretBaseUnion

Tulajdonság értéke

port

A Presto-kiszolgáló által az ügyfélkapcsolatok figyelésére használt TCP-port. Az SSL letiltásakor az alapértelmezett érték 8080, az SSL engedélyezése esetén az alapértelmezett érték 443.

port?: any

Tulajdonság értéke

any

serverVersion

A Presto-kiszolgáló verziója. (azaz 0,148-t) Csak az 1.0-s verzióhoz használható.

serverVersion?: any

Tulajdonság értéke

any

timeZoneID

A kapcsolat által használt helyi időzóna. A beállítás érvényes értékei az IANA időzóna-adatbázisában vannak megadva. Az 1.0-s verzió alapértelmezett értéke az ügyfélrendszer időzónája. A 2.0-s verzió alapértelmezett értéke a kiszolgálórendszer időzónája

timeZoneID?: any

Tulajdonság értéke

any

trustedCertPath

A .pem fájl teljes elérési útja, amely megbízható hitelesítésszolgáltatói tanúsítványokat tartalmaz a kiszolgáló SSL-kapcsolaton keresztüli csatlakozáskor történő ellenőrzéséhez. Ez a tulajdonság csak akkor állítható be, ha SSL-t használ a saját üzemeltetésű integrációs modulon. Az alapértelmezett érték az integrációs modullal telepített cacerts.pem fájl. Csak az 1.0-s verzióhoz használható.

trustedCertPath?: any

Tulajdonság értéke

any

type

Polimorfikus diszkriminatív, amely meghatározza az objektum különböző típusait

type: "Presto"

Tulajdonság értéke

"Presto"

username

A Presto-kiszolgálóhoz való csatlakozáshoz használt felhasználónév.

username?: any

Tulajdonság értéke

any

useSystemTrustStore

Megadja, hogy a rendszer megbízhatósági tárolójából vagy egy megadott PEM-fájlból használjon-e ca-tanúsítványt. Az alapértelmezett érték hamis. Csak az 1.0-s verzióhoz használható.

useSystemTrustStore?: any

Tulajdonság értéke

any

Örökölt tulajdonság részletei

annotations

A társított szolgáltatás leírásához használható címkék listája.

annotations?: any[]

Tulajdonság értéke

any[]

ALinkedService.annotationstól örökölt

connectVia

Az integrációs modul referenciája.

connectVia?: IntegrationRuntimeReference

Tulajdonság értéke

A LinkedService.connectViaörökölte

description

Társított szolgáltatás leírása.

description?: string

Tulajdonság értéke

string

Örökölte aLinkedService.description

parameters

A társított szolgáltatás paraméterei.

parameters?: {[propertyName: string]: ParameterSpecification}

Tulajdonság értéke

{[propertyName: string]: ParameterSpecification}

Örökölte aLinkedService.parameters

version

A társított szolgáltatás verziója.

version?: string

Tulajdonság értéke

string

Örökölte aLinkedService.version